Problem 4. The figure below shows the cross section of a levee that is underlain by a 2-m-thick permeable sand layer. For the sand layer, ksand is 0.3 ft/day and the porosity (n) is 0.4. Elv. 180 ft Levee Elv. 170 ft 5 ft 100 ft Impervious Sand Determine the followings. (20 pts) (a) What is the flow rate? (b) How long does it take for water to flow from reservoir to the ditch?

Solution

Solution:-

a) q = kp * i *A

q= discharge

k= coefficient of permeability/ hydraulic conductivity

i = Hydraulic gradient Change in length/ total length = (180-170) / `100 =0.1

kp =  coefficient of percolation = k/porosity = (n) = 0.3 / 0.4 =0.75 ft /day

A= area = 100 * 2 *3.28 =656 ft2

q= 0.75 * 0.1 * 656

q = 49.2 ft3/ft/ day

b) time = volume / discharge

time = 100 * 2*3.28 *1/ 49.2

= 13.33 days
